海纳百川

登录 | 登录并检查站内短信 | 个人设置 网站首页 |  论坛首页 |  博客 |  搜索 |  收藏夹 |  帮助 |  团队  | 注册  | RSS
主题: 谁能看出来产生陪审团的程序是错的?
回复主题   printer-friendly view    海纳百川首页 -> 众议院
阅读上一个主题 :: 阅读下一个主题  
作者 谁能看出来产生陪审团的程序是错的?   
所跟贴 谁能看出来产生陪审团的程序是错的? -- 随便 - (2226 Byte) 2007-10-18 周四, 上午10:16 (797 reads)
捂被子笑






加入时间: 2006/04/13
文章: 2142

经验值: 19765


文章标题: 严肃一次: 该程序是有问题. 随便说的对 (184 reads)      时间: 2007-10-19 周五, 上午12:04

作者:捂被子笑众议院 发贴, 来自 http://www.hjclub.org

且不说srand() 和seed 的问题. 有两个问题肯定能说名该程序不严谨.也许不会每次出错,但出错的可能性是存在的. 从这方面讲,该程序是不合格的.

1. 只能从前20人中选jury. (这点单从程序本身来讲没错,但user requirement analysis 可能错了. 很明显嚒, 干嘛只能从前20人选呀?)
2. names [ j ] =names [ n -1 ] ,有可能上次选的是names [ n](就是现在的names [ n-1]). 下次选的有是names [ j ]. 尽管这种事发生的概率很小,但是有可能的.




作者:捂被子笑众议院 发贴, 来自 http://www.hjclub.org
返回顶端
阅读会员资料 捂被子笑离线  发送站内短信
显示文章:     
回复主题   printer-friendly view    海纳百川首页 -> 众议院 所有的时间均为 北京时间


 
论坛转跳:   
不能在本论坛发表新主题
不能在本论坛回复主题
不能在本论坛编辑自己的文章
不能在本论坛删除自己的文章
不能在本论坛发表投票
不能在这个论坛添加附件
不能在这个论坛下载文件


based on phpbb, All rights reserved.
[ Page generation time: 0.087548 seconds ] :: [ 19 queries excuted ] :: [ GZIP compression enabled ]